About Marc A. Egerman
Marc A. Egerman is a scholar working on Aging, Otorhinolaryngology and Nephrology, having authored 9 papers that have together received 963 indexed citations. Recurring topics across this work include Muscle Physiology and Disorders (4 papers), Head and Neck Cancer Studies (2 papers) and Head and Neck Surgical Oncology (2 papers). The work is most often cited by research in Aging (85 citations), Physiology (414 citations) and Rehabilitation (89 citations). Marc A. Egerman has collaborated with scholars based in United States and Switzerland. Frequent co-authors include David J. Glass, Tea Shavlakadze, Angelika Meyer, Shenglin Ma, Sophie Brachat, Andrew S. Brack, Susanne E. Swalley, Ieuan Clay, Gaëlle Laurent and Carsten Jacobi. Their work appears in journals such as Cell Metabolism, The FASEB Journal and The Journals of Gerontology Series A.
